Project Overview

Earthwork and Grading Plant Expansion

This project consisted of site work for a $1,400,000,000 UREA Plant Expansion including all general earthwork and grading, subgrade and sub ballast for a railcar loop and loading facility, road grading and base rock, laydown area for new plant construction materials (60 acres), and storm drainage for the site.

• 170,000 CY of site fills
• 390,000 CY of site cuts
• 167 acres of site clear and grub
• 100,000 TNS of rock surfacing
• 35,000 TNS of rail sub ballast for 12,000 LF of rail
• 10,000 LF of storm drainage (6” to 60”)
• 37 each precast storm drainage structures
• 410,000 SY of subgrade prep
• 55,000 CY of topsoil for seeding
• 400,000 SY of finish grading
